President Droupadi Murmu advised newly inducted IAS officers to focus on the upliftment of underprivileged citizens, emphasizing their duty to serve the public. She highlighted the opportunity these officers have to bring about transformative changes in people's lives, encouraging them to work with honesty, integrity, and sensitivity. The President also urged officers to visit their places of posting after some time to see the impact of their work and to prioritize resolving public interest issues.
